netbox/dcim/querysets.py
Normal file
72
netbox/dcim/querysets.py
Normal file
@ -0,0 +1,72 @@
|
||||
from __future__ import unicode_literals
|
||||
|
||||
from django.db.models import QuerySet
|
||||
from django.db.models.expressions import RawSQL
|
||||
|
||||
from .constants import IFACE_ORDERING_NAME, IFACE_ORDERING_POSITION, NONCONNECTABLE_IFACE_TYPES
|
||||
|
||||
|
||||
class InterfaceQuerySet(QuerySet):
|
||||
|
||||
def order_naturally(self, method=IFACE_ORDERING_POSITION):
|
||||
"""
|
||||
Naturally order interfaces by their type and numeric position. The sort method must be one of the defined
|
||||
IFACE_ORDERING_CHOICES (typically indicated by a parent Device's DeviceType).
|
||||
|
||||
To order interfaces naturally, the `name` field is split into six distinct components: leading text (type),
|
||||
slot, subslot, position, channel, and virtual circuit:
|
||||
|
||||
{type}{slot}/{subslot}/{position}/{subposition}:{channel}.{vc}
|
||||
|
||||
Components absent from the interface name are ignored. For example, an interface named GigabitEthernet1/2/3
|
||||
would be parsed as follows:
|
||||
|
||||
name = 'GigabitEthernet'
|
||||
slot = 1
|
||||
subslot = 2
|
||||
position = 3
|
||||
subposition = 0
|
||||
channel = None
|
||||
vc = 0
|
||||
|
||||
The original `name` field is taken as a whole to serve as a fallback in the event interfaces do not match any of
|
||||
the prescribed fields.
|
||||
"""
|
||||
sql_col = '{}.name'.format(self.model._meta.db_table)
|
||||
ordering = {
|
||||
IFACE_ORDERING_POSITION: (
|
||||
'_slot', '_subslot', '_position', '_subposition', '_channel', '_type', '_vc', '_id', 'name',
|
||||
),
|
||||
IFACE_ORDERING_NAME: (
|
||||
'_type', '_slot', '_subslot', '_position', '_subposition', '_channel', '_vc', '_id', 'name',
|
||||
),
|
||||
}[method]
|
||||
|
||||
TYPE_RE = r"SUBSTRING({} FROM '^([^0-9]+)')"
|
||||
ID_RE = r"CAST(SUBSTRING({} FROM '^(?:[^0-9]+)([0-9]+)$') AS integer)"
|
||||
SLOT_RE = r"CAST(SUBSTRING({} FROM '^(?:[^0-9]+)([0-9]+)\/') AS integer)"
|
||||
SUBSLOT_RE = r"COALESCE(CAST(SUBSTRING({} FROM '^(?:[^0-9]+)(?:[0-9]+\/)([0-9]+)') AS integer), 0)"
|
||||
POSITION_RE = r"COALESCE(CAST(SUBSTRING({} FROM '^(?:[^0-9]+)(?:[0-9]+\/){{2}}([0-9]+)') AS integer), 0)"
|
||||
SUBPOSITION_RE = r"COALESCE(CAST(SUBSTRING({} FROM '^(?:[^0-9]+)(?:[0-9]+\/){{3}}([0-9]+)') AS integer), 0)"
|
||||
CHANNEL_RE = r"COALESCE(CAST(SUBSTRING({} FROM ':([0-9]+)(\.[0-9]+)?$') AS integer), 0)"
|
||||
VC_RE = r"COALESCE(CAST(SUBSTRING({} FROM '\.([0-9]+)$') AS integer), 0)"
|
||||
|
||||
fields = {
|
||||
'_type': RawSQL(TYPE_RE.format(sql_col), []),
|
||||
'_id': RawSQL(ID_RE.format(sql_col), []),
|
||||
'_slot': RawSQL(SLOT_RE.format(sql_col), []),
|
||||
'_subslot': RawSQL(SUBSLOT_RE.format(sql_col), []),
|
||||
'_position': RawSQL(POSITION_RE.format(sql_col), []),
|
||||
'_subposition': RawSQL(SUBPOSITION_RE.format(sql_col), []),
|
||||
'_channel': RawSQL(CHANNEL_RE.format(sql_col), []),
|
||||
'_vc': RawSQL(VC_RE.format(sql_col), []),
|
||||
}
|
||||
|
||||
return self.annotate(**fields).order_by(*ordering)
|
||||
|
||||
def connectable(self):
|
||||
"""
|
||||
Return only physical interfaces which are capable of being connected to other interfaces (i.e. not virtual or
|
||||
wireless).
|
||||
"""
|
||||
return self.exclude(form_factor__in=NONCONNECTABLE_IFACE_TYPES)

netbox/ipam/querysets.py
Normal file
38
netbox/ipam/querysets.py
Normal file
@ -0,0 +1,38 @@
|
||||
from __future__ import unicode_literals
|
||||
|
||||
from utilities.sql import NullsFirstQuerySet
|
||||
|
||||
|
||||
class PrefixQuerySet(NullsFirstQuerySet):
|
||||
|
||||
def annotate_depth(self, limit=None):
|
||||
"""
|
||||
Iterate through a QuerySet of Prefixes and annotate the hierarchical level of each. While it would be preferable
|
||||
to do this using .extra() on the QuerySet to count the unique parents of each prefix, that approach introduces
|
||||
performance issues at scale.
|
||||
|
||||
Because we're adding a non-field attribute to the model, annotation must be made *after* any QuerySet
|
||||
modifications.
|
||||
"""
|
||||
queryset = self
|
||||
stack = []
|
||||
for p in queryset:
|
||||
try:
|
||||
prev_p = stack[-1]
|
||||
except IndexError:
|
||||
prev_p = None
|
||||
if prev_p is not None:
|
||||
while (p.prefix not in prev_p.prefix) or p.prefix == prev_p.prefix:
|
||||
stack.pop()
|
||||
try:
|
||||
prev_p = stack[-1]
|
||||
except IndexError:
|
||||
prev_p = None
|
||||
break
|
||||
if prev_p is not None:
|
||||
prev_p.has_children = True
|
||||
stack.append(p)
|
||||
p.depth = len(stack) - 1
|
||||
if limit is None:
|
||||
return queryset
|
||||
return list(filter(lambda p: p.depth <= limit, queryset))
